Can G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ER run The Mountain?

Great

The G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ER handles The Mountain well at 1080p, delivering approximately 210 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 158 FPS.

The MountainGeForce GTX 1660 SUPER FPS Data

Quality1080p1440p4K
Low329 fps247 fps131 fps
Medium263 fps197 fps105 fps
High210 fps158 fps84 fps
Ultra171 fps128 fps68 fps

Estimated FPS · actual performance may vary based on drivers and settings

Minimum System Requirements

CPU
Intel® Core™ i5-4590
GPU
NVIDIA GeForce GTX 760
RAM
4 GB
